Still as Death

af J. A. Kazimer

MedlemmerAnmeldelserPopularitetGennemsnitlig vurderingSamtaler
215,250,702 (5)Ingen
When it comes to murder, sometimes it's better to be lucky than good . . .When she's not busy dodging the killer alligators and small-town gossip of Gett, Florida, Charlotte Lucky has her hands full keeping the family distillery up and running and planning her grandfather's seventy-fifth birthday celebration. Then an arrogant old flame from her Hollywood days comes to town to woo her back with a proposal of marriage, and she rejects his offer with a burst of anger and no regrets-until the celebrity heartthrob is found murdered and she's fingered as the main suspect.Certain that the town's sheriff-a member of the rival Gett clan-would be more than happy to see her hang for the crime, Charlotte gets to work tracking down the real killer. Navigating her way through family secrets and her own simmering romantic feelings for a man who's as dangerous as he is charming, Charlotte will put her neck on the line to unravel a sinister scheme before her next drink turns out to be her last . . .Praise for the first book in the Lucky Whiskey mystery series: "An entertaining and riveting read with more plot twists than a bakery full of pretzels, A Shot of Murder showcases author J. A. Kazimer's complete mastery of the genre." -Midwest Book ReviewAbout the Author: When she isn't looking for a place to hide the bodies, J. A. (Julie) Kazimer spends her time with a pup named Killer. Other hobbies include murdering houseplants and avoiding housework. She lives in Denver. Visit her website at jakazimer.com.… (mere)

Even though I read book one yesterday, I still think that this one could easily stand alone because it answers any background questions even as they arise. We're with Charlotte, her grandfather, and their distillery in rural nowheresville and it starts with a grand birthday celebration until the local banker unexpectedly drops dead while Charlotte is unknowingly getting an engagement ring from a former acquaintance. Say what? She was busy seeing a man die right before her while the Hollywood doofus is busy making tabloid news and totally missed his putting a ring with a large diamond on her finger. The next day she has a row with said doofus as she tries to return the ring and he gets nasty. The day after that, the sheriff needs a few words with her because the doofus has been blunt force traumaed to death. The next thing you know her childhood nemesis is unwillingly helping her investigate because he seems to be in the frame as well. Good fun and good sleuthing complete with red herrings and plot twists and some good laughs along the way. I loved it!
